Output 21f5bd7909a2280618ac8d4d67d5a8a3ff7ee8ce8f0df29474d6377034bef387:0

value
58526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 532d5abf2ab1ec774933ee64b20fe00b1a045958 OP_EQUALVERIFY OP_CHECKSIG
address
18aoRCyLyKx8eye9SjfNVGhUGbZA5fB64M
transaction
21f5bd7909a2280618ac8d4d67d5a8a3ff7ee8ce8f0df29474d6377034bef387
spent
true